 It is remarkable with what Christian fortitude and resignation we can bear the suffering of other folks

 It is the folly of too many to mistake the echo of a London coffee-house for the voice of the kingdom.

 It is useless to attempt to reason a man out of a thing he was never reasoned into

 It was a bold person that first ate an oyster.

 Just get the right syllable in the proper place.

 Laws are best explained, interpreted and applied by those whose interest and abilities lie in perverting, confounding and eluding them

 Laws are like cobwebs, which may catch small flies, but let wasps and hornets break through.

 Lord! I wonder what fool it was that first invented kissing.

 May you live all the days of your life.

 May you live every day of your life.

 Men are contented to be laughed at for their wit, but not for their folly

 Most sorts of diversion in men, children and other animals, are an imitation of fighting

 My nose itched, and I knew I should drink wine or kiss a fool.

 No man was ever so completely skilled in the conduct of life, as not to receive new information from age and experience.

 No preacher is listened to but time, which gives us the same train and turn of thought that elder people have in vain tried to put into our heads before
